The improvement began pretty much as soon as Mike Gordon increased his holding and took (pretty much) sole responsibility for the club, leaving Henry free to concentrate on the Red Sox.
He has been behind every major decision that has led us to this point, and on the transfer side, the much maligned Michael Edwards is showing just how astute he really is now that he has someone working with him rather than pulling in a different direction
Let's not forget, Klopp had to be persuaded to buy Salah, and who did that persuading?
Our management team, for the first time in a while, are all pulling in the same direction, and FSG have shown this by laying out world record sums on individual players; a sure sign they believe totally, not just in Klopp, but the whole team he works with.
